#d9d6d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9d6dd is composed of 85.1% red, 83.9%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.8% cyan, 3.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 265.7 degrees, a saturation of 9.3% and a lightness of 85.3%. #d9d6d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b3adbb.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#d9d6d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f7f6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9d6dd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d9d9da is the less saturated color, while #d4b6fd is the most saturated one.
